    Adding up to 100 is an essential skill for children ages 5-7, laying a strong foundation for their future math abilities. At this age, children are developing their number sense, comprehension of place value, and ability to think critically about numbers. Understanding how to add to 100 encourages them to recognize patterns and relationships in numbers, which fosters a deeper mathematical understanding.

    Moreover, mastering addition to 100 promotes confidence and a positive attitude towards math. When children achieve mastery in this area, they are more likely to feel motivated and competent when faced with more complex mathematical concepts later on. This confidence can mitigate math anxiety and enhance overall academic performance.

    Additionally, skills learned while adding to 100 can be applied to real-life situations, such as budgeting, understanding time, and problem-solving. These foundational math skills are not only useful in school but are also essential for daily tasks as they grow older.

    For parents and teachers, emphasizing the importance of adding to 100 ensures children are well-equipped for future academic challenges and provides them with essential life skills. Nurturing these abilities helps set children on a path to success in mathematics and enhances their overall cognitive development.
